March 2025 monthly summary for oxygenxml/userguide: Deliveries center on documentation quality, reliability, and publishing efficiency. DITA Documentation Improvements consolidated and clarified documentation, including glossary reference dropdown location corrections, clearer values syntax for form controls (handling commas), removal of outdated add_to_toc reference in DITA integration docs, added cross-references for validation scenarios, and clarification of the Apply Transformation Scenario(s) shortcut behavior. AI Positron service integration reliability increased by extending the default read timeout from 120 seconds to 600 seconds, providing a longer window for AI service interactions. DITA publishing configuration was enhanced with a new DITAOT config to exclude specific add-on variants (webauthor, fusion, waCustom) when publishing add-ons, ensuring only relevant content is included in the final output. These changes improve developer and user experience, reduce build times, and increase overall system reliability and relevance of published content.
